Problem
Discolored cooktop covers
Tools
Philips screwdriver
Repair & Advice
Contrary to "web advice" you can't just turn the burners counterclockwise to remove them from the cooktop cover. You need to disassemble the bottom portion of the cooktop module first (multiple philips screws), disconnect gas piping (don't lose two washers), remove ignitors and then you can remove the burners from the cooktop (turning ccw). Reassemble and your done. First one took 20 - 30 minutes to figure it out. Second one took 5 minutes.

Problem
Wonderful stove, but boy, those pans under the burners were ugly due to time and use.
Tools
Phillips screwdriver
Repair & Advice
Important info that I didn’t have: you don’t need to pull the stove out and dismantle the front and/or top. I tried to pull the pans up, but they wouldn’t budge, so I started dismantling. Turns out that if I’d tried to lever up the pans from the back instead of the sides, they would have come up. To be clear, insert flat pry tool like a flathead screwdriver at the back of a pan and pry it up to remove
